Mainline is a Git-native memory layer for coding agents. It gives agents and reviewers repo memory before the diff: prior decisions, constraints, abandoned approaches, validation notes, and related in-flight work. AI agents make code cheap to produce and harder to review. Mainline makes the intent reviewable before the generated code lands. Review the intent before you review the code. The Problem Code review was built for a world where humans wrote most of the code. The diff was expensive, so it was usually small enough for reviewers to infer the intent.

How this security grade is produced

Grades come from a rule-based scan built on the SlowMist agent-security taxonomy, covering 11 red-flag categories including credential harvesting, data exfiltration, and curl | sh installers. It is a first-layer scan, not a manual audit — we say so rather than overstate it.

The scale of the problem is documented independently: Liu et al. (2026), in a study of 31,132 agent skills, report that 26.1% contain security vulnerabilities. Our own full-catalog census is published as a citable open dataset.
